The Holiday Specs 3D Glasses are made by American Paper Optics, a manufacturer of paper 3D eyewear. These glasses come in both plastic and paper versions and have patented holographic lenses that feature more than 10-holiday images. These images are visible when you wear the specs while looking at any bright, single point of light.
